Sarit Firon, Managing Partner at Team8, was speaking at a panel held as part of Calcalist's InvesTech conference in collaboration with IBI Capital. According to Firon, in recent months there has been growth in the number of new companies opening: "There is an amazing phenomenon, the determination of employees to close the gap created by the war is tremendous."

Israeli tech’s rapid recovery in 2024 has surprised many, but not Sarit Firon. The veteran investor behind Team8 Capital’s biggest exits explains why founders, employees, and global investors continue to bet on Israel—even in the toughest times.
